Blended Learning: The Middle Ground That Works
One of the central approaches gaining traction is the blended learning model, which serves as a harmonious blend of traditional and digital teaching methods. This pedagogical strategy enhances instructional methods without completely abandoning the familiar in-person classroom environment.
For instance, a high school in Texas witnessed a remarkable 22% increase in assignment completion rates after adopting a blended learning model that combined the Canvas Learning Management System (LMS) with traditional lectures. Students would review recorded lessons at home before engaging in collaborative problem-solving during classroom hours—a teaching technique often referred to as the “flipped classroom.”
This approach not only supports innovative teaching strategies but also sets the stage for active learning. By arriving in class prepared, students contribute meaningfully to discussions, allowing teachers to focus on more complex topics rather than reiterating basic concepts.
Practical Tools Educators Are Using Right Now
In today’s educational landscape, certain digital education tools have emerged as favorites among teachers, particularly for their ease of use and ability to significantly enhance student engagement:
- Kahoot!: This interactive tool transforms quizzes into competitive, game-like experiences, making learning not only fun but effective. It’s especially popular in middle school science and history courses, where students respond in real-time to questions using their devices.
- Seesaw: Tailored for younger learners, Seesaw allows students to document their learning through photographs, videos, and voice recordings. This creates engaging digital portfolios that parents can review in real time, fostering a crucial link between school and home.
- Padlet: A versatile platform, Padlet acts as a virtual bulletin board where students can collaboratively brainstorm. It’s ideal for subjects such as English and social studies, where discussions can benefit from shared thoughts and insights.
- Flipgrid: Encouraging students to respond with video allows for a rich diversity of voices, especially benefiting quieter students who may feel overshadowed in traditional discussions.
Each of these tools exemplifies a fundamental shift in educational practice from passive learning to active participation—a critical component of effective online learning.
Data-Driven Decisions Replace Guesswork
An equally significant evolution in education is the use of data analytics to inform teaching strategies and improve student outcomes. Teachers today can access detailed data sets—tracking time spent on assignments, understanding quiz performance, and analyzing engagement patterns—that were previously lacking.
A middle school in Colorado capitalized on analytics provided by its digital learning platform. The data revealed that students often disengaged during 25-minute independent reading blocks. In response, educators restructured these sessions into shorter, interactive segments, resulting in improved engagement scores within weeks. This nimble response illustrates that enhancing student productivity increasingly relies on interpreting data effectively rather than merely collecting it.

Personalized Learning Paths: Meeting Students Where They Are
Perhaps no development has reshaped classrooms more quietly—or more effectively—than adaptive learning technology. These digital education tools analyze individual student performance and adjust content difficulty in real time, ensuring no one falls through the cracks or gets bored waiting for peers to catch up.
Take DreamBox Learning, a math platform now used in over 1,700 school districts nationwide. Its algorithm doesn’t just check whether an answer is right or wrong; it examines how a student arrived at that answer, adjusting future problems accordingly. A district in Virginia reported that students using DreamBox for just 60 minutes weekly showed measurable growth equivalent to an extra 1.8 months of instruction compared to peers on traditional worksheets.
This kind of individualized pacing directly supports online learning effectiveness, particularly for students who previously felt invisible in one-size-fits-all lesson plans.
Gamification Goes Beyond Points and Badges
Gamification often gets dismissed as a gimmick, but the psychology behind it runs deeper than leaderboards and digital trophies. When implemented thoughtfully, game mechanics tap into intrinsic motivation—the drive students feel when progress itself becomes rewarding.
Classcraft, a platform that turns classroom management into a role-playing game, has been adopted by schools across California and Ohio specifically to address behavioral engagement. Teachers report that students who rarely participated in traditional settings became noticeably more invested once collaborative “quests” tied academic tasks to team-based objectives.
These outcomes reinforce a broader truth: innovative teaching strategies succeed not because they digitize existing methods, but because they reimagine motivation itself.
Accessibility Features That Level the Playing Field
An often-overlooked advantage of modern Digital Learning Platforms is their built-in accessibility infrastructure. Text-to-speech functions, adjustable font sizes, closed captioning, and translation tools have quietly transformed classrooms for students with learning differences or limited English proficiency.
A school district in Florida serving a large population of English language learners integrated Google Read&Write across its curriculum. Within one semester, teachers observed a 15% improvement in reading comprehension scores among ELL students, largely attributed to real-time translation and word prediction features.
These accessibility gains matter for a simple reason: they widen the definition of who gets to fully participate, rather than merely accommodating a smaller group on the margins.
Building Digital Citizenship Into the Curriculum
As screen time increases, so does the responsibility to teach students how to navigate digital spaces responsibly. Forward-thinking districts are embedding digital citizenship lessons directly into their technology rollout, covering topics like online etiquette, misinformation, and digital footprints.
Common Sense Education’s free curriculum has been adopted by thousands of U.S. schools, offering grade-specific lessons that pair naturally with existing platforms like Google Classroom. This proactive approach ensures that as schools work to enhance student engagement, they simultaneously cultivate the judgment students need to use these tools safely and productively.

Frequently Asked Questions
What are some effective strategies for using Digital Learning Platforms to boost student engagement?
Effective strategies include incorporating interactive tools like quizzes and polls, using virtual breakout rooms for collaborative learning, and integrating multimedia resources such as videos and podcasts. Additionally, leveraging gamification can make learning more enjoyable and motivating for students, fostering a more engaged learning environment.
How can educators measure student productivity in Digital Learning Platforms?
Educators can measure student productivity by tracking participation metrics, assignment completion rates, and engagement analytics provided by the platform. Tools like analytics dashboards can help assess students’ progress through assessments and quizzes, allowing educators to identify areas where students may need additional support.
What role does feedback play in enhancing student learning on Digital Learning Platforms?
Timely and constructive feedback is crucial as it helps students understand their strengths and areas for improvement. Utilizing features like instant feedback on quizzes and personalized comments on assignments can enhance learning, keeping students motivated and on track with their educational goals.
